13 > > > der letzte Emerge world wurde leider von der Steckdose beendet.
14 > > > Der nächste Versuch mein System hoch-zufahren klappte recht
15 > > > gut, lediglich meine Eingabegeräte (Maus und Tastatur) sind tot, das
16 > > > Runterfahren ist auch nur durch die harte Methode. Der
17 > > > Rechner lässt sich gut über andere Betriebssysteme sowohl von der
18 > > > Festplatte wie auch DVD-Laufwerk mit Eingabegeräte bedienen.
19 > > >
20 > > > Weis jemand wie ich mein Gentoo wieder in Ordnung bringen kann?
21 >
22 > Kann es sein das bei deinem Update auch der xorg-server aktualisiert
23 > wurde ?
24 > Dann hast du vlt. einfach nur vergessen erneut alle x11-drivers zu
25 > kompilieren...
26 >
27 > Wird z.B in diversen englischsprachigen Threads im Gentoo Forum behandelt:
28 > http://forums.gentoo.org/viewtopic-p-6239558.html
29 >
30 >
31 > Einfach beim nächsten Systemstart den interaktiven Bootmodus wählen
32 > und den X Server nicht starten.
33 > Oder eben die Methode über die Live CD wählen.

147 * Please ensure that /usr/src/linux points to a configured set of Linux
148 sources.
149
150 Bitte sichergehn, dass /usr/src/linux auf deine Kernel Sources zeigt.
151
152 eselect kernel list bzw. eselect kernel set [...] hilft dir dabei.
